Governor returns ordinance to Karnataka govt

Bangalore, January 15: Karnataka Governor H R Bhardwaj has returned to the BJP government its ordinance on a scheme that sought to regularise “illegal” buildings saying he cannot bypass the legislature and the judiciary.

“I have sent back the file”, he told reporters in response to questions about the scheme that sought to regularise with penalty, houses and buildings that violated norms.

“Basically in 2004, this matter started when (then) governor T N Chaturvedi returned it (ordinance) with this message. Then they (the state government) took three years to rectify…objections and then law was passed,” Bhardwaj said.

“It was (then) challenged in the high court and the high court has stayed it. Do you expect me to bypass legislature and judiciary both and do something which I don’t know at all. So, I said after the (BBMP) elections, debate it and come back,” he said.
